Hi all. I have been trying to make a test web app but it does not seems to work on firefox, and the main problem is that it is not caching at all my manifest. I tested the same file on Chrome and it worked flawlessly. Hope you guys can help me.

You guys can check and test the file here:

www.nortrix1.com/cache/teste.htm

Hi,

Please check this on a new profile. A new profile would have the default Firefox settings and would also be free of add-ons.

hi Vivek!

Thanks! It seems to work now....Do you have any idea why it was not working on my default profile????? Can it be an add-on? Some configuration???

I'm not sure, it could have been either. The permissions for a site can be checked by right-clicking on the page and View Page Info > Permissions. Alternatively via Tools > Page Info or click the site favicon on the location (address) bar and More Information. The corresponding settings for these permissions except for Share Location is in the Tools > Options: Content, Privacy, Security and Advanced > Network tabs. The offline storage setting is in Advanced > Network. Options > Advanced

You can check the installed extensions and their Options via Tools (Alt + T) > Add-ons > Extensions. Here you can also disable them individually or en masse.
